Feb 5, 2014 | G-BLOG | 0 comments

Feburary 5, 1973

CN Tower Construction Begins

In 1973 was the start of construction on CN Tower, a communications transmission mast and observation post to be the world’s tallest freestanding structure.
In 1995, the American Society of Civil Engineers classified the CN Tower as one of the Seven Wonders of the Modern World.
The CN Tower serves as a telecommunications hub while providing world-class entertainment and a wide range of unique attractions, exhibits and food and beverage venues.

Stay connected to G98.7FM all day every day with our G987 app available in Android and iPhone applications for your listening pleasure!


Submit a Comment

Your email address will not be published. Required fields are marked *